Border Battle Renewed

The Minnesota Vikings’ final push to the playoffs begins on Saturday night with a trip to Lambeau Field to face the Green Bay Packers.

The Vikings have already secured a home playoff game by winning the NFC North, but they would like to secure a first-round bye, too.

Minnesota Vikings left tackle Riley Reiff’s sprained ankle has improved, and the team has listed him as questionable to play at Green Bay. Reiff has returned to practice on a limited basis, after missing the last game.

The Packers, meanwhile, won’t be close to full strength. Wide receiver Davante Adams is out with a concussion. Outside linebacker Nick Perry is doubtful because of ankle and shoulder injuries.
